Engineering Salaries in Haarlem, Netherlands

Salaries vary by company, region and experience. All amounts are gross (before tax). Holiday allowance (8%) is added on top.

In Haarlem, mid-level automotive engineers earn competitive salaries starting from approximately €3,000 to €4,200 gross per month, depending on experience, certifications, and specific employer policies. Overtime work, shift premiums, or specialized skills can increase total compensation. Given the minimum wage in the Netherlands is €14.71/hour, these salaries provide a clear premium reflecting skill level and industry standards.

Beyond salary, engineers benefit from various non-compensatory perks such as holiday allowance of 8%, pension schemes, travel reimbursement, and opportunities for professional development through training. These benefits contribute to a stable, rewarding career while supporting work-life balance and financial security.

Working in Engineering

Automotive engineers in Haarlem typically work standard office hours from 8:30 to 17:00, with some roles requiring occasional flexibility for project deadlines or testing schedules. Daily responsibilities often include designing components, testing prototypes, participating in team meetings, and collaborating with multidisciplinary teams to develop innovative automotive solutions. The work environment emphasizes safety, precision, and continuous learning.

Dutch labor rights protect engineers through collective labor agreements (CAO) that specify working hours, overtime policies, and holiday entitlements. Overtime is compensated either through extra pay or time off, and safety regulations are strictly enforced to ensure a secure workplace. Employees benefit from at least 20 days of paid holiday annually, plus additional holiday allowances, promoting a healthy work-life balance.

Automotive Engineer Career Path

Starting as a mid-level automotive engineer, professionals often progress from technical roles to project management or specialized engineering positions. Gaining experience in CAD design, control systems, or electric vehicle development can open doors to senior roles within automotive firms or R&D departments.

To reach advanced levels, engineers should pursue certifications such as accredited project management or specialized technical courses in emerging automotive technologies like electromobility or autonomous driving. Building a strong portfolio of projects, developing leadership skills, and staying updated on industry trends are key to accelerating career advancement within Haarlem’s automotive sector.
